Runbook: chip-reader account recovery (Stridemark RF-7). If the reader loses its paired account mid-race, do not re-flash. Hold SYNC for five seconds, select Recover, and confirm the race ID. Reviewer note: recovery bypasses normal auth because the device is offline trackside. The offline recovery prompt accepts only the passphrase below.

vault phrase of faduf-hagug = frair-eliath-briion-quenix-kasael

Validators in Checkrow load as plugins from the registry at boot. Each plugin exports a validate() returning a verdict plus reasons; reviewers should reject any plugin doing I/O inside validate(). Versions are pinned in plugins.lock — flag unpinned entries. Local runs need the registry reachable, and the registry refuses anonymous pulls, so the pull credential belongs in the env file on the line right after this sentence.

env line for fafof-fahag: LEDGER_TOKEN5=f8790

Facilities Ticket — Cleaning Crew Access, Brindle Annex

For new starters handling evening lock-up: the Sorano Cleaning crew arrives nightly at 21:30 via the annex side door. Check their rota sheet, note arrival in the log, and ensure the storeroom is relocked afterward. To let them through the side door, enter the access code below.

badge for yaweg-hafog: bdg-GX-6

Subject: Orders soft-delete cut-over done

Cut-over finished Sunday for the Brindlecart orders table. Hard deletes disabled; all removals now set a tombstone flag plus timestamp. Purge job runs nightly against records past retention. No schema access changes; existing grants unchanged. Audit trail captures actor and reason on every soft delete. For your review, the retention and purge settings now live in production are below.

deployment values, yadug-bawif:
[framir]
team = pelox
access_code = ac_a38ab2
owner = tamion.julael
host = framir.tolvaqlabs.test
port = 11211
peer = tammir.zemvargrid.local
salt = 2215ef03
pin = 1541